What is Roof Sheathing?

Roof sheathing, also known as roof decking, is the layer of material that is installed directly onto the roof trusses or rafters. It provides the structural support and base for the roof covering, such as shingles or metal panels. Roof sheathing acts as a solid and stable foundation, ensuring the roof's overall integrity.

The Importance of Roof Sheathing

Roof sheathing plays a crucial role in the performance and durability of your roof. It serves as a barrier against external elements, such as wind, rain, snow, and even pests. Additionally, it helps distribute the weight of the roof covering evenly, preventing any sagging or structural issues.

Moreover, roof sheathing enhances the insulation and energy efficiency of your home. It acts as an additional layer of thermal resistance, keeping your indoor climate controlled and reducing energy consumption. It also provides a base for the installation of insulation materials, further enhancing your home's energy efficiency.

Types of Roof Sheathing Materials

There are several types of roof sheathing materials available, each with its own unique characteristics and advantages. Let's take a closer look at some commonly used options:

  1. Plywood: Plywood is a popular choice for roof sheathing due to its strength, durability, and resistance to moisture. It is made from thin layers of wood veneer that are glued together, creating a solid and sturdy panel. Plywood comes in various thicknesses and grades, allowing you to choose the most suitable option for your specific roofing needs.
  2. OSB (Oriented Strand Board): OSB is another commonly used roof sheathing material. It is constructed from strands of wood that are compressed and bonded together with resin. OSB is known for its affordability and structural stability. However, it is important to ensure proper installation and ventilation with OSB, as it is more susceptible to moisture-related issues compared to plywood.
  3. Structural Insulated Panels (SIPs): SIPs are a modern and energy-efficient option for roof sheathing. They consist of two outer layers of sheathing material, such as plywood or OSB, with a layer of insulation sandwiched in between. SIPs offer excellent thermal performance, reducing energy loss and enhancing overall energy efficiency. They are often used in sustainable and eco-friendly construction projects.
  4. Metal Roof Decking: In some cases, metal panels or sheets are used as roof sheathing instead of traditional wood-based materials. Metal roof decking offers exceptional durability, fire resistance, and low maintenance. It is commonly used in commercial or industrial building applications, providing a robust and long-lasting roofing solution.
